Understanding American Surrogacy Expenses: What to Expect

Planning to embark on the journey of surrogacy in America? It's a momentous decision that involves significant financial considerations. While the joy of welcoming a child into your family is immeasurable, being aware about the potential costs can help you make strategic choices and manage this process with greater ease.

Here's a glimpse into the typical expenses you might encounter during your American surrogacy journey:

* **Agency Fees:** Surrogacy agencies play a crucial role in matching recipient parents with appropriate surrogates. Their fees typically cover matching services, legal assistance, and administrative help.

* **Surrogate Compensation:** Surrogates are compensated for their time, effort, and emotional contributions. This compensation can fluctuate depending on factors such as the surrogate's experience, location, and length of the surrogacy journey.

* **Medical Expenses:** These expenses encompass all medical services related to the pregnancy, including fertility treatments, prenatal care, delivery costs, and postnatal attention.

* **Legal Fees:** Legal representation is essential throughout the surrogacy process to ensure compliance with legal requirements and protect the rights of all parties involved.

Remember that these are just some of the primary expenses associated with American surrogacy. The total cost can vary depending on individual circumstances and choices. It's always best to discuss a reputable surrogacy agency or legal professional for a personalized estimate of potential costs.

Surrogacy Costs in America: A Detailed Breakdown

Venturing into the world of surrogacy demands a significant financial commitment. In this country, surrogacy costs can fluctuate widely based on a multitude of factors, such as the agency you choose, your geographical area, the type of surrogacy arrangement, and complementary services.

To present a clearer picture, here's a typical breakdown of common surrogacy costs in America:

  • Surrogacy Fees: This is often a significant expense, ranging from between $30,000 and $60,000.
  • Agency fees: Agencies coordinate the matching process and legal aspects, usually ranging in price to between $15,000 and $30,000.
  • Legal expenses: Legal assistance is crucial throughout the surrogacy journey. Expect to invest around $5,000 to $10,000.
  • Medical costs: This covers pre-pregnancy screening, fertility procedures, prenatal care, delivery, and postpartum care. Costs can vary greatly but around $10,000 to $25,000.

Keep in mind that this serves as a general estimate. Make sure to consult with qualified agencies for a personalized cost breakdown based on your unique situation.
